Qi Xing Xu Han Ting granules


Cure for perspiration due to debility

          Spontaneous perspiration and night sweats are syndrome of disorder in the bodily function of discharging sweat due to imbalance of yin and yang, and weakness of the superficial and pores. Therefore cases of hyperhidrosis mostly belong to asthenia syndrome

          Xu han ting originates from the prescription of concha ostreae powder recorded in the famous medical classics prescriptions of Taiping benevolent dispensary in Song dinasty (960-1279 AD) and is refine with modern pharmaceutical techniques based on the originated prescription but with additions and deductions. This prescription can not only be applied in treatment of spontaneous perspiration due to deficiency of qi but also in night sweats due to yin deficiency. The heavy dose of calcined concha ostreae as a main drug in the prescription tends to nourish yin and suppress the hyperactive yang to astringe and cease sweating. Radix astragali seu hedysari sweet in taste and warm in nature, applicable to invigorating qi, serves as a supplement to consolidate the superficial and cease perspiration. Fructus tritici levis can invigorate heart qi, nourish heart yin and stop the discharging of sweat. Excessive sweating or prolonged sweating in turn will exhaust yin qi. Radix oryzae glutinosae and fructus jujubae are added so as to enhance the effect of invigorating qi, strengthening the spleen and nourishing yin to cease perspiration. The combined application of the above drugs makes qi and yin nourished and replenished and the superficial consolidated. Thus perspiration can be ceased
          Xu han ting has been applied in clinical experiments respectively in the affiliated hospital of the Guang zhou college of TCM and other 3 hospitals in the treatment of spontaneous perspiration and night sweat caused by application of antibiotic in treatment of various types of inflammatory diseases or syndromes of spleen deficiency, deficiency of both the spleen and lung and lung qi deficiency caused by other diseases. The total effective rate comes to 95.8%. In treatment of spontaneous perspiration is grown up due to syndrome of deficiency of yang qi, both qi and yin and that of yin blood caused by chemotherapy or radiotherapy in treatment of tumour, or inflammatory and chronic diseases, the effective rate amounts to 96%
